Leveraging Digital Tools to Plan, Build, and Deliver the Next Evolution of the Grid

The energy transition impacts all aspects of energy production, delivery and consumption, and exposes the drawbacks inherent in outdated, time-intensive workflows. To remain competitive in this dynamic environment, utilities are rethinking their approach to digitizing documents and data to provide powerful features that guide future projects, identify maintenance priorities, reduce outages, and increase revenues.

In this event, they will explore key factors driving the energy transition, dive into how utilities are expanding and integrating their use of data-driven technologies, and showcase some of the strategies that utilities can begin to put in place today to bolster their competitiveness in an uncertain and dynamic market.
